Maximizing Space and Light: Tips and Tricks

Maximizing space and light is a key aspect of creating an inviting and spacious home. To achieve this, start by decluttering your space and getting rid of any items that are not essential. Use storage solutions such as baskets, shelves, and organizers to keep things organized and tidy. To maximize natural light, choose light-colored curtains or blinds that allow sunlight to filter through. Mirrors are also a great way to enhance natural light and create the illusion of a larger space. Additionally, consider using light-colored paint on walls and invest in reflective surfaces like glass or mirrored furniture. These simple tips and tricks can help you transform your space into a bright and airy sanctuary without breaking the bank.

Thrifty Shopping Habits for Unique Decor Items

Thrifty shopping habits can help you find unique decor items without breaking the bank. First, try visiting thrift stores and vintage shops, where you can often find interesting and one-of-a-kind pieces at a fraction of the original price. Don't be afraid to haggle or negotiate for a better deal. Another option is online marketplaces and auction sites, where you can browse through a wide variety of used and vintage items. Estate sales and garage sales are also great places to discover hidden gems. Remember to keep an open mind and be patient when searching for decor items on a budget, as it may take some time to find the perfect piece that fits your style and budget.

Maintaining an Elegant Look with Creativity and Minimal Spending

Maintaining an elegant look with creativity and minimal spending is not only possible but also exciting. Many affordable home decor ideas can transform your space without breaking the bank. Start by decluttering and organizing your belongings to create a clean and polished look. Next, incorporate creativity by repurposing old items or DIY-ing new ones. For example, you can transform an old ladder into a stylish bookshelf or use mason jars as candle holders. Additionally, focus on small details that make a big impact, such as adding plants or changing the lighting fixtures. With a bit of imagination and resourcefulness, you can achieve a stunning and sophisticated home decor that reflects your personal style without spending a fortune.
